Advanced Skill Certificate in Body Dysmorphic Disorder Intervention Training Programs offer specialized instruction in treating individuals struggling with BDD. These programs equip mental health professionals with evidence-based therapeutic techniques and a deep understanding of the disorder's complexities.
Learning outcomes typically include mastering c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) adaptations specifically designed for BDD, developing proficiency in exposure and response prevention (ERP), and understanding the role of body image in the condition. Participants also learn to differentiate BDD from other related disorders and to effectively manage the challenges presented by this often debilitating condition. The curriculum incorporates the latest research and best practices in BDD treatment.
Program durations vary, typically ranging from several weeks to several months, depending on the intensity and format of the training (e.g., online versus in-person). Some programs may be offered part-time, making them accessible to working professionals. The specific length is detailed within each program's description.
